    APGA governorship candidate declare wanted over murder of Monarch in Ebonyi

    Police in Ebonyi State have declared the governorship candidate of the All Progressive Grand Alliance (APGA), Ifeanyi Odoh, wanted over the gruesome m¥rder of the traditional ruler of Umu-Ezekoha Community in Ezza North, Eze Christopher Igboke Ewa.

    It was gathered that the monarch was sh%t d£ad by an assassin at about 8:30 p.m on Monday, February 27, in his palace.

    The command’s spokesperson, Onome Onovwakpoyeya, in a statement on Monday, March 6, declared Mr Odoh and nine others wanted over the m¥rder of the monarch.

    The nine others, according to the police, are Samuel Onyekachi Aligwe, Peter Orogwu (aka one boy), Chukwudi Aliewa (aka Ezza) and Chika Ezealigbo.

    Others are Nnaemeka Egede (aka Champaign), Nnabuike Okohu, Ogobuchi Agbom (aka Okiri), Nonso Obasi, and Ikechukwu Nwoba (aka Solid).

    The police appealed for information from the public that could lead to the arrest of the suspects.
